Preview: Admin Console

Thanks @cifvts,

Excellent questions and thoughts, to speak to each individually:

  1. Admin Console setup

The thinking was once you installed Mattermost we’d:

a) present screens for an IT admin to setup database and email settings (identical UI to SITE SETUP tabs at the bottom of the Admin Console).

b) next, you’d get screens to select an admin console URL, username and email and end up in an Admin Console with the tab shown in the image at the top of this thread. In the background, we’d actually create an “Admin Console” team, but instead of the regular UI, we’d have the Admin Console UI

c) We’d have a tutorial prompt to setup your first team–from the “+” sign next to TEAM SETTINGS, and then that new team would appear where “SpinPunch Games” is shown in the above image.

d) From here the IT Admin could manage any team in the system and also change global settings, add other admins, etc.

  1. TEAM SETTINGS

IT Admins in the Admin Console will manage TEAM SETTINGS by opening a team from the “306 more teams…” link, which opens a dialog where teams can be searched and selected, then changing settings and closing the team with the “x” button. We’re thinking about scaling from small groups to enterprise with the “306” number,

For “Team Admins” who are the end users in charge of managing a team site, we’ll replace the current “Team Settings” dialog with the ability to go to a “mini Admin Console” that’s just the TEAM SETTINGS for that team.

c) Getting to Admin Console

When a user has an email address shared across multiple teams, we automatically offer the user the ability to navigate among those teams from the main menu:

With the Admin Console, IT Admins can access it either via “http://example.com/ADMIN_CONSOLE_URL_CHOSEN” (defaults to /mm-admin if not changed on setup) or navigate to it as “Admin Console” as they would from another team.

d) For SITE REPORTS at the top

Perhaps we should call it DASHBOARD and have it collapsed on first login, so it’s just one tab on which a user starts off, and all the other admin options are available below.

Highly appreciate the feedback, it really helps us think through the design.